Supermarkets have again engaged in ‘locking’ certain retail items up to prevent shoplifting efforts. One aspect has been the inclusion of barriers at a leading supermarket chain, which requires customers to scan receipts before they are allowed to exit the premises.
In London, watch theft has again been in focus. The capital accounts for 4 in 10 watch thefts nationwide, according to data. A man riding a luxury bicycle was violently assaulted in a robbery, while the home of actor, Benedict Cumberbatch, was attacked by a man while the family was at home.
